They sure do..1.5 way also.
This is a two way..you can see the two diamond shape ramps (ramp angles) on both diff halves. They are exactly the same, hence two way. I guess projectD said something along the same lines. You can see them in the second pic. The two thingies at the top.

You're right, just checked:

Zenki 2way
41301-TA005
Zenki 1.5way
41301-TA006

Kouki 2way
41301-AE804
Kouki 1.5way
41301-AE805
